Chicago lost 1-3 to Calgary on January 16 at the United Center Arena and suffered its third defeat in the last four matches. Nick Foligno scored the only goal after passes from Colton Dacha and Landon Sluggert. Spencer Knight blocked 20 shots, but the game was broken by special teams, the team did not realize a single majority of four attempts. Chicago ranks sixth with a 19-21-7 record.

On January 16, Boston confidently defeated Seattle 4-2 on TD Garden ice, extending the winning streak to five matches and completing the home stretch without defeats. Marat Khusnutdinov scored the pucks after Charlie McAvoy passed, Viktor Arvidsson, Mark Kaselik outnumbered and David Pastrniak into an empty net. Jeremy Swayman played solidly, deflecting 26 of 28 shots. Boston is in fifth place in the Atlantic Division with a 27-19-9 record.
